Dio you mind me asking what she did to save the rig? This is something I've thought about...the "what would I do if" scenario.
Kind of a long story but will attempt to make it short.
We live in a private RV park and keep our MH parked in our second lot and sometimes use it for a guest room. DW had gone over to fire up the fridge to put in some treats, turned on the fridge and heard a small explosion and saw smoke coming out around the sides of the fridge, rushed outside and while calling 911 turned off the gas at the tank and rushed around back where the fire was in the slideout. We just happened to have a hose hooked up to the water supply and she was able to put water on the fire immeadiately until the fire dept arrived. If we had been in a RV park I honestly think the whole rig would have gone up in flames. All damage was contained to the living room slide and no smoke damage internally. We were definitely lucky in that respect.

Greyhawk 33DS electricial issue

I have a problem with my 07 33DS that I and the dealer and Jayco have been trying to figure out. So I thought why not bring it up here and see is anyone has had anything simular.
The levelers, rear camera display, and electric door locks do not work on their own. They will work if I hold in the AUX battery button. These are the only devices I know of at this time, there could be more. My feeling is these are all chassis battery powered and maybe there is a grounding or miswiring somewhere that is common to these devices only. The dash lights, radio, heater/AC, lights all work fine.
I'm open for ideas

Had a fire yesterday

DW went over to the MH yesterday to turn on the refridgerator, heard funny noises and smoke started coming out of the sides of the fridge, then a small explosion and flames shooting up the outside of the motorhome.DW called 911 and with the help of a neighbor was able to get the fire partially contained with a water hose before the fire department arrived. The fridge is in the slide that was extended so all damage is contained in the slide and no smoke damage internally.
To make a long story short the fire dept thinks it was a faulty gas regulator in the fridge. We are now waiting for the claim adjuster. The MH is still under first year warrantee so I need to notify the dealer. Going to be along process I'm afraid and am thinking the slide is going to need to be replaced. I have taken pictures in case legal issues develope.
Any thoughts and comments would be appreciated.
